Abstract

The present disclosure provides an interaction method, an apparatus, a device, and a storage medium, which relate to the computer technology field, including: determining a corresponding predetermined screenshot scenario and at least one corresponding screenshot picture in response to receiving a screenshot operation on a media content display page; displaying a predetermined control; and generating target media content corresponding to the predetermined screenshot scenario based on the predetermined screenshot scenario and the at least one screenshot picture in response to a trigger operation on the predetermined control.

[0044] In some embodiments, the method further includes performing a first predetermined process on the screenshot picture to obtain the related image of the screenshot picture before displaying the related image of the screenshot picture, thereby automatically pre-processing the screenshot picture based on a predetermined screenshot scenario to make it more suitable for generating media content and making the related image viewed by the user closer to the target media content.

[0045] In some embodiments, generating target media content corresponding to the predetermined screenshot scenario based on the predetermined screenshot scenario and the at least one screenshot picture in response to a trigger operation on the predetermined control includes performing a second predetermined process on the at least one screenshot picture based on the predetermined screenshot scenario in response to a predetermined trigger operation on the predetermined control, and generating target media content corresponding to the predetermined screenshot scenario based on a process result of the second predetermined process, wherein the screenshot pictures participating in the second predetermined process may include some or all of the at least one screenshot picture.

[0046] Optionally, the first predetermined process and / or the second predetermined process may include at least one of a cropping process, a scaling process, and a target information adding process. The first predetermined process and the second predetermined process may be the same or different, i.e., may include the same or different items among the above items. For example, the first predetermined process may include a cropping process, and the second predetermined process may include a scaling process. To facilitate the description of the specific contents of each of the above items, they will hereinafter be collectively referred to as "predetermined processes."

[0047] In some embodiments, the predetermined processing may include cropping a target area in the screenshot picture, where the target area may be an area including a predetermined interaction control, which is typically used by a user for human-computer interaction or interaction with other users, and which contains less information and can be removed for upcoming media content. Illustratively, the predetermined screenshot scenario includes a current page of the predetermined application program including predetermined information related to the predetermined media content, including comment information, i.e., when a user performs a screenshot operation on a comment area of ​​a media content piece, cropping the target area in the screenshot picture includes cropping an input area for comment information in the screenshot picture.

[0048] In some embodiments, the predetermined process may include performing a shrinking process on the screenshot picture based on a predetermined ratio. The predetermined ratio is not limited to a specific value and may be, for example, 80%. For example, a media content display page of a certain application program typically includes setting interaction controls, such as a like control, a favorite control, or a forward control, and further includes display information such as title information. The setting interaction controls and display information are typically located at the top, bottom, or both sides of the page. By performing a shrinking process on the screenshot picture, the image content in the screenshot picture can be avoided from the setting interaction controls and display information when displaying the target media content, making it easier for the user to view the image content in the screenshot picture.

[0049] In some embodiments, the predetermined processing may include adding target information based on the screenshot picture. Here, the target information may be, for example, text information or image information. Exemplarily, the predetermined screenshot scenario includes a situation in which the current page of the predetermined application program includes predetermined information, including comment information, related to the predetermined media content. For example, when a user performs a screenshot operation on a comment area of ​​a media content work and the screenshot screen does not include or only includes a portion of the image of the original media content work, adding target information based on the screenshot picture may include stitching image information of the predetermined media content based on the screenshot picture. Therefore, in some application scenarios, comment information covers all or part of the predetermined media content. Stitching image information of the predetermined media content based on the screenshot picture can help a user viewing the target media content intuitively and quickly grasp the related predetermined media content and further understand the meaning of the comment information in the screenshot picture, thereby enhancing the user experience. Optionally, the image information of the predetermined media content may include, for example, a cover picture of the predetermined media content, or an image of the predetermined media content displayed when a user triggers the display comment area.

[0050] 3 is a schematic diagram of another interface interaction according to an embodiment of the present disclosure. As shown in FIG. 3, a screenshot operation is received on a media content display page. The current page includes comment information 301 related to a specific media content. After determining a current specific screenshot scenario, a specific control 302 and a related image 303 of the screenshot picture are associated and displayed. The specific control 302 and the related image 303 are in the same floating box control. Here, before displaying the related image 303, an input area 304 of the comment information in the screenshot picture is cropped. After a user inputs a setting trigger operation for the specific control 302, a reduction process is performed on the screenshot picture based on a predetermined ratio to obtain the processing result. Corresponding target media content 305 is generated and distributed based on the processing result. As shown in FIG. 3, the image content of the screenshot picture included in the target media content 305 avoids the setting interaction controls and display information at the top, bottom, and right of the media content display page. When a user browsing the work clicks on a specific viewing control or specific information in the already distributed targeted media content 305, they can jump to a display page of the specific media content and be positioned in the associated comments area.

[0051] FIG. 4 is a schematic diagram of another interface interaction according to an embodiment of the present disclosure. As shown in FIG. 4, a media content display page receives a screenshot operation. After determining a current predetermined screenshot scenario, a predetermined control 401 and a related image 402 of the screenshot picture are associated and displayed. The predetermined control 401 and the related image 402 are located in the same subpage 403. The related image 402 is a preview media content generated based on the screenshot picture. The subpage 403 may be displayed on top of the current page, and a semi-transparent layer may be added between the subpage 403 and the current page. Here, before displaying the related image 402, the comment information input area in the screenshot picture is cropped, and the screenshot picture is reduced based on a predetermined ratio to obtain the preview media content. After the user inputs a set trigger operation for the predetermined control 401, corresponding target media content is generated and distributed based on the preview media content. It should be noted that the size of the target media content matches the media content display page size of a predetermined application program, but the size of the preview media content is smaller than the size of the target media content. When generating the target media content, a background image may be filled around the preview media content to achieve the size of the target media content, or the preview media content may be overlaid with a background image of a predetermined size, and the preview media content may be positioned in the center of the background image to match the predetermined size with the size of the target media content. Optionally, as shown in FIG. 4 , a subpage 403 may receive a user's editing operation and trigger a predetermined control 401 after the editing is completed.

[0053] In some embodiments, displaying the predetermined control includes displaying the predetermined control in a first predetermined style when it is determined that the number of screenshot operations in the predetermined screenshot scenario received within a predetermined time period is greater than a predetermined count threshold, and / or displaying the predetermined control in a second predetermined style when it is determined that the number of screenshot operations in the predetermined screenshot scenario received within a predetermined time period is equal to or less than a predetermined count threshold, where the second predetermined style is different from the first predetermined style, thereby facilitating displaying the predetermined control in different styles based on the number of screenshots taken and prompting the user to take different actions for different numbers of screenshots.

[0054] Here, the predetermined time period is not limited to a specific range and may be, for example, within a recent predetermined time period. The predetermined time period may be a fixed value, for example, within the recent five minutes, or may be a dynamically changing value. Optionally, the predetermined time period may be included within the display time range of a single media content in the predetermined application program. This allows screenshot pictures corresponding to multiple screenshot operations to be associated with the same media content, thereby improving the quality of the target media content. For example, the predetermined time period is the length of time that the currently displayed media content has been played. The predetermined number threshold value is not limited to a specific value and may be, for example, 1 or 2.

[0055] Optionally, in response to a trigger operation on a predetermined control of a first predetermined style, target media content corresponding to the predetermined screenshot scenario is generated based on a plurality of screenshot pictures corresponding to the predetermined screenshot scenario and screenshot operations received within a predetermined time period.

[0056] Optionally, in response to a trigger operation on a predetermined control of a second predetermined style, target media content corresponding to the predetermined screenshot scenario is generated based on a screenshot picture corresponding to the predetermined screenshot scenario and a recently received screenshot operation.

[0057] In some embodiments, the method includes obtaining a plurality of screenshot pictures corresponding to each screenshot operation greater than a predetermined number of times threshold after displaying the predetermined control of the first predetermined style, and determining at least one target screenshot picture based on the plurality of screenshot pictures, wherein the at least one target screenshot picture is used to generate the targeted media content, thereby generating the targeted media content based on the target screenshot picture of the plurality of screenshot pictures, thereby increasing flexibility in generating the targeted media content.

[0058] In some embodiments, obtaining a plurality of screenshot pictures corresponding to each screenshot operation greater than the predetermined count threshold includes entering a capture selection page in response to a second predetermined trigger operation on a predetermined control of the first predetermined style, and displaying a plurality of screenshot pictures on the capture selection page corresponding to each screenshot operation greater than the predetermined count threshold, wherein determining at least one target screenshot picture based on the plurality of screenshot pictures includes receiving a user selection operation based on the capture selection page, and determining at least one target screenshot picture from the plurality of screenshot pictures based on the selection operation, thereby allowing a user to freely select screenshot pictures for generating target media content and improving user experience.
